The CRISPR market is a subset of the genomics market that focuses on the use of CRISPR-Cas9 technology for gene editing. CRISPR-Cas9 is a powerful tool that enables scientists to make precise changes to the genome of living organisms. This technology has been used to develop treatments for a variety of diseases, as well as to create new crops and livestock. CRISPR-Cas9 technology has also been used to create gene drives, which are designed to spread a desired trait through a population.
The CRISPR market is highly competitive, with a number of companies offering products and services related to gene editing. These companies include Editas Medicine, Intellia Therapeutics, CRISPR Therapeutics, Caribou Biosciences, and ERS Genomics.
